Any DTCs besides 0300 ? Is a certain cylinder(s) showing misfire ?
Plugs , wires, coils , coil wiring harness have been verified OK ?
Fuel psi checking out ?
#6
New plugs, wires, tested all coils and replaced one, new map, new maf, new Delphi fuel pump. I took it too the dealer to run a diagnosis, they checked everything and came to conclusion that the exhaust valve springs on cylinders 1&3 are bad.
